Uvod v AWS funkcije

Ko slišite izraz 'Računalništvo v oblaku', kaj vam pride na pamet? AWS kajne? AWS je hčerinsko podjetje Amazona, ki svojim uporabnikom zagotavlja storitve računalništva v oblaku na zahtevo. Vse se je začelo leta 2006, ko se je Amazon odločil predstaviti svojo informacijsko infrastrukturo, ki gosti svet amazon.com. Od takrat se nenehno izboljšujejo in uvajajo nove storitve na svoji spletni strani AWS. Pred kratkim je v podjetju REINVENT 2019 AWS uvedel storitev 5G, tj. AWS valovno dolžino, storitve strojnega učenja, kot so Amazon CodeGuru, Amazon Fraud Detector itd. V tej temi bomo spoznali funkcije AWS.

Lastnosti AWS

Tu je seznam zgoraj omenjenih funkcij AWS:

1. Enostaven postopek prijave

V AWS nam ni treba podpisovati nobenega sporazuma, vse kar potrebujemo, so e-poštni ID in podatki o kreditni / obremenitveni nalogi. AWS ponuja tudi brezplačno stopnjo za eno leto, v kateri je večina priljubljenih storitev do določene omejitve.

2. Enostavno in obračunsko uro

Vsak primerek ali vsaka storitev ima mikro obračunavanje, tako da, če imate primerek EC2, vam bomo zaračunali na uro, kar je zelo pregledno, celo vedro S3 se zaračuna na GB osnovi. Nadzorna plošča za obračunavanje v AWS je zelo preprosta, nudijo nam integrirano nadzorno ploščo za obračunavanje, ki vam daje poročilo, ki ga lahko izvlečemo glede na naše zahteve, kot je mesečno, na podlagi storitev itd.

3. AWS obsega 3 pomembne stebre računalništva v oblaku

AWS ima tri pomembne stebre IaaS, PaaS in SaaS, ki so pojasnjeni spodaj.

  • IaaS (Infrastruktura kot storitev)

Temelj katere koli oblačne arhitekture je njena infrastruktura in AWS zagotavlja osnovno računalniško infrastrukturo, kot so shranjevanje, strežniki in omrežni viri itd., In jo večinoma uporabljajo skrbniki IT. Storitev AWS EC2 temelji na konceptu IaaS, s pomočjo katerega lahko vzpostavimo spletno stran ali analiziramo podatke itd.

  • PaaS (platforma kot storitev)

PaaS večinoma uporabljajo razvijalci programske opreme, saj zagotavlja čas izvajanja za razvoj in testiranje aplikacij brez skrbi za infrastrukturo. Amazonov elastični beanstalk je dober primer PaaS.

  • SaaS (programska oprema kot storitev)

SaaS uporabnikom v oblaku omogoča uporabo spletnih aplikacij v oblaku, kot je AWS SNS enostavna storitev obveščanja, SES e-poštna storitev, ki je podobna e-poštnim storitvam, kot sta Gmail ali Yahoo Mail.

4. Vseprisotnost

AWS Cloud obsega 69 območij razpoložljivosti v 22 geografskih regijah po vsem svetu in ima od leta 2019 na voljo več kot 170 storitev, ki so razdeljene v različne skupine, kot so računanje, shranjevanje, varnost, analitika itd. Kot je prikazano na spodnji sliki .

5. Prilagodljivost in elastičnost

Pri AWS skalabilnost je možnost, da računalniški vir povečate, pomanjšate ali zmanjšate, ko se povpraševanje po AWS poveča ali zmanjša za to, imamo storitev samodejnega skaliranja.

Elastičnost je zmožnost razdelitve dohodnega prometa aplikacij po več ciljih, kot so IP naslovi, primerki, storitve sporočanja, zabojniki, itd. Za to imamo storitev Elastic uravnotežilec obremenitve v AWS.

6. Prožnost

V AWS lahko izberete svoj operacijski sistem, programski jezik, vrsto zbirke podatkov, lokacijo, kamor želite dostaviti svojo vsebino itd., In plačujete samo za tisto, kar uporabljate, brez kakršnih koli obveznosti. Tako se boste bolj osredotočili na razvoj in poslovanje, ne pa na učenje tehnologij, ki se jih ne zavedate ali nimate strokovnega znanja in gradite svojo infrastrukturo z obstoječimi znanji. V programskih jezikih lahko izbirate med java, python, go, json, ruby, C Sharp, Node JS itd.

S sistemom AWS CloudFormation lahko preprosto premikate vašo lokacijsko aplikacijo v oblak in stroškovno učinkovito. Z AWS OpsWorks lahko v nekaj sekundah posodobite več virov. Tako boste namenili več časa za razvoj aplikacije in njeno rast, namesto da bi skrbeli za infrastrukturo.

7. Veliko storitev Amazona

Tu je kratek opis nekaterih priljubljenih storitev Amazon.

  • EC2 (elastični računalniški oblak)

To je storitev, ki vam nudi gole strežnike / stroje, s katerimi lahko zaženete in zaženete programsko opremo. Zmogljivost in procesno moč stroja lahko izberete glede na vaše potrebe.

  • VPC (virtualni zasebni oblak)

AWS ne dovoljuje popolnega nadzora nad oblakom, nameščajo vam koščke njihovega oblaka, ki je VPC. VPC vam omogoča, da ustvarite omrežja v oblaku in nato zaženete svoje strežnike v teh omrežjih.

  • S3 (enostavna storitev shranjevanja)

S3 vam omogoča nalaganje in skupno rabo datotek z ustvarjanjem vedrov S3, ki so podobna mapam, predvsem gre za sistem za shranjevanje datotek in ne za shranjevanje blokov. V S3 lahko gostite tudi statično spletno mesto.

  • Služba za relacijske baze podatkov

RDS vam omogoča zagon in upravljanje baze podatkov v oblaku. RDS ima vse glavne tipe DB-jev od SQL Serverja do PostgreSQL, v RDS-u lahko ustvarimo DB in dodelimo pomnilnik v skladu z našo zahtevo in jih tudi naredimo odpovedne odpovedi s pomočjo podvajanja med regijami, nedavno je AWS lansirala Aurora, ki trdijo, da je zelo zmogljiv DB.

  • Elastično uravnoteženje obremenitve (ELB) in samodejno skaliranje

To je storitev, ki vam daje možnost, da naloženi dohodni promet naložite na več naprav in tako povečate svojo spletno aplikacijo na poljubno število uporabnikov. Na voljo imamo tudi samodejno skaliranje, ki ELB-u doda zmogljivost, tako da vaša aplikacija nikoli ne bo padla zaradi obremenitve.

  • AWS Lambda

To je računalniški motor brez strežnika. V Lambdi morate navesti ustrezno kodo, da boste svoje delo opravili in plačali samo čas računanja. AWS Lambda samodejno prilagodi lestvici glede na obremenitev. Podpira Python, node.JS, C oster, Ruby, Go in Java.

8. Stabilnost in zaupanja vreden prodajalec

Razpoložljivost in trajnost mnogih Amazonovih storitev znašata približno 99, 99%, kar je eden od razlogov, da podjetja, kot so Spotify, Netflix, Adobe in Airbnb, gostijo svoje podatke na AWS.

9. Enostavno učenje in potrdila

AWS ponuja tudi podrobno dokumentacijo za vsako storitev, poleg tega pa ima tudi programe usposabljanja in certificiranja AWS, kar omogoča učenje in razumevanje AWS preprosto. Potrdila AWS so eno najbolj cenjenih certifikatov na trgu

AWS je tudi vodja na trgu v letu 2019, kot je prikazano na spodnji sliki.

Zaključek

Zaradi visokokakovostnih storitev, ki se redno posodabljajo, ima podpora 24 × 7, podrobno dokumentacijo za vsako storitev in nižjo ceno v primerjavi z drugimi ponudniki storitev v oblaku in tradicionalno infrastrukturo AWS najvišjo tržno mejo. Poleg tega Amazon tudi veliko vlaga v širitev svoje mreže in uvajanje bolj tehnološko naprednih in enostavnih storitev.

AWS ima tudi aktivno skupnost, ki lahko pomaga uporabnikom razumeti AWS okolje, prav tako pa lahko razpravljajo o vseh težavah, s katerimi se srečujejo med razvojem. AWS ima tudi privzete predloge za številne storitve, kar uporabniku pomaga, da se izogne ​​ponovnemu izumljanju kolesa. Vse te lastnosti AWS so vodilne na trgu.

Priporočeni članki

To je vodnik za funkcije AWS. Tukaj razpravljamo o seznamu funkcij spletnih storitev Amazon, ki podjetjem pomaga pri zagotavljanju kakovostnih storitev in podpira njihova podjetja. Obiščite lahko tudi druge naše sorodne članke, če želite izvedeti več -

  1. AWS Data Pipeline
  2. AWS CodeCommit
  3. AWS posode
  4. Prednosti AWS

Kategorija: